  • Bills' Leonard Floyd: Achieves season-high sack total

    Floyd recorded four tackles (three solo) including 2.5 sacks in Sunday's 32-6 win versus the Jets.

    Floyd logged two-plus sacks for the second time this season, putting him within half a sack of the second double-digit sack year of his career. He probably won't see quite so many pass-rushing opportunities in Week 12 at Philadelphia, but he remains a viable IDP option anyway.

  • Bills' Leonard Floyd: Practices fully Thursday

    Floyd (ankle) returned to a full practice Thursday.

    Initially injured in Week 2, Floyd took last Wednesday off before fully practicing Thursday and Friday. He appears to be following the same routine this week. Across three starts, the 31-year-old has recorded 3.5 sacks and five QB hits as a weapon off the edge for Buffalo.

  • Bills' Leonard Floyd: Still dealing with injury

    Floyd (ankle) will not practice Wednesday, Chris Brown of the Bills' official site reports.

    Floyd has been dealing with the injury since suffering it in the team's Week 2 win over the Raiders, although he did play Sunday against the Commanders. It's unclear if he aggravated the injury or if Wednesday can be viewed more as a maintenance or recovery day for the veteran linebacker. His practice status for Thursday will be worth monitoring and likely bring more clarity to his availability Week 4 against the Dolphins.

  • Bills' Leonard Floyd: Looks good for Sunday

    Floyd (ankle) was a full participant at practice Friday and does not carry an injury designation ahead of Sunday's game at Washington.

    After missing practice Wednesday, Floyd was able to log a limited session Thursday before finally recording a full practice Friday, setting him up to play in Week 3. He'll look to get back in the sack column by chasing down an inexperienced Sam Howell.
